#1d27f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d27f5 is composed of 11.4% red, 15.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 53.7%. #1d27f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a4eff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#1d27f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d27f5 has RGB values of R:29, G:39,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 1910773.

Shades and Tints of #1d27f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010212 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d27f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818291 is the less saturated color, while #141ffe is the most saturated one.
